One of the simplest ways to find any home improvement skilled is to ask for suggestions from associates or neighbors. Has someone in your neighborhood gotten a new steel roof not too long ago? Ask them who they used and if they are pleased with the work. They will let you know how well the contractor was to work with, if they accomplished the job on time, and if any issues would keep them from working with them once more.

Trim Overhanging Branches: Overhanging tree branches can lure moisture and debris, leading to premature shingle decay. Keep branches trimmed away from the roof. Examine Flashing: Repeatedly test and maintain the flashing around chimneys, vents, and other roof penetrations to make sure they are watertight. The lifespan of cedar shingle roofing can differ depending on a number of components, together with the kind of cedar, local weather, maintenance, and publicity to the weather. On common, a effectively-maintained cedar shingle roof can final anywhere from 20 to 40 years.
